Description des services:
|
Programs and services for geriatric clients who are homebound due to complex physical, cognitive and/or psychiatric conditions * Offers three streams for clients:
- consultation: comprehensive assessment and recommendations to referring provider
- shared care: shares primary care with clients' family physician
- primary care: assumes primary care for clients who do not have a family physician
Services provided by geriatricians, registered nurses, nurse practitioners, occupational therapist, physiotherapist, and social workers * There are three streams available:
- Geriatric Consultation: A Comprehensive Geriatric Assessment in the home, with recommendations to the referring health care provider
- Shared Care: ICCT does home visits and shares the primary care with the individual’s family physician. This is usually a short-term intervention
- Primary Care: ICCT may assume primary care for homebound/bedbound people who cannot access to a family doctor
Referrals from a physician or nurse practitioner for this service can be initiated through our Central Navigation, which adheres to a no-wrong-door approach. This assists community agencies, primary care providers, and other healthcare professionals in navigating Ambulatory Services at Baycrest. Admissibilité / population desservie:
|
Adults over the age of 65 with multiple medical, functional, or psychosocial problems and unable to attend appointments onsite. Clients must reside within the catchment area of Keele Street to Yonge Street and Steeles Avenue to St. Clair Avenue
